  2. Greatest Hits (Barry Manilow album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greatest_Hits_(Barry...

    Greatest Hits is the first greatest hits album by singer/songwriter Barry Manilow, released in 1978. The album was certified 3× Platinum in the US, [1] and would be Manilow's last of that certification, as of 2021. [2] It also features the new single, "Ready to Take a Chance Again", which reached #11 in the US the same year. [3]

  3. That's Me (album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/That's_Me_(album)

    It is named after the ABBA song "That's Me". In addition to solo hits by Fältskog, the album includes three ABBA songs with lead vocals by Agnetha and the recently discovered 1981 demo of "The Queen of Hearts". Complementing this album is the 1996 compilation My Love, My Life, which concentrates on her Swedish-language hits.

  4. Greatest Hits (Alice Cooper album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greatest_Hits_(Alice...

    The album's cover art was designed by Ernie Cefalu and features a sepia-toned Drew Struzan illustration of the band members in front of a 1930s garage, accompanied by such period movie stars as Humphrey Bogart, Clark Gable, Robert Taylor, Edward G. Robinson, Jean Harlow, Peter Lorre, and Groucho Marx.

  5. Greatest Hits (Billy Ocean album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greatest_Hits_(Billy_Ocean...

    Greatest Hits is a greatest hits album by British R&B singer and songwriter Billy Ocean, released in 1989.The album features Ocean's biggest hit singles of the 1980s, along with two new singles, "I Sleep Much Better (In Someone Else's Bed)" and "Licence to Chill", the latter of which became Ocean's twelfth and final US top 40 hit to date, reaching No. 32.

  7. Greatest Hits (Alice in Chains album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greatest_Hits_(Alice_in...

    The album featured two covers. The first cover features a photo of boxer Gene Fullmer receiving a crushing right from Neal Rivers during their 10-round bout at Madison Square Garden on November 15, 1957. [2] The unofficial second cover features an image of the members of the band's heads from the Facelift photoshoot without the text on the cover.

  9. Greatest Hits (Queen album)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greatest_Hits_(Queen_album)

    Greatest Hits was released alongside Greatest Flix, a 60-minute compilation released on VHS video, LaserDisc, and CED Videodisc of all the videos Queen had made up until that point in chronological order, and Greatest Pix, a 96-page paperback book edited by Jacques Lowe which featured photos of the band taken by Neal Preston.
